With watercolour she expresses herself, her moods... without words and brings out the warmth and radiance of luminosity trough her subjects even in a cloudy setting. She will make you feel the wind, the fog, the hot humidity of the sea breeze coming in, the depth of the foliage or the texture of bark.
As a child, she is exposed to art and photography at her father's store, Art & Photo, and after experimenting with other mediums, she chooses watercolour for its brilliance, transparency, purity and challenges.
Trough photography, she learned to see and describe the brightness of light, shade, bringing out a wide range of delicate nuances. Her photos are the source of her inspiration and subjects. Her watercolours are the result of her meticulous choice of pigments to render texture or silkyness, pure whites or luminous darks.
In 1994 she founded her art school to teach watercolour in her atelier at home to small groups. She lives in Sherbrooke, Québec
